Geneva, circa 1820.Fine 18K gold quarter repeating musical watch with automaton scene.

CHF 14,000 - 18,000

Sold: CHF 18,400

C. Three body, "forme quatre bagettes" with engine-turned back. Hinged gilt brass cuvette. D. Eccentric gold engine-turned with Roman numerals on a polished chapter ring, outer two-coloured gold pierced and engraved automaton scene over a silver engine-turned ground, depicting a cellist and a lady playing the harp in a garden. M. 24''', gilt brass double train with free standing barrels, cylinder escapement with plain brass three-arm balance and flat balance spring. Repeating on gongs by depressng the pendant. Pin-disc musical train with 28 tuned steel teeth on either side of the disc and driving the automata by means of cams and levers.Diam. 61 mm.
